The Cades Cove Preservation Association has collected wonderful historic photos, recipes and fascinating cultural information from 16 Smokies families. This amazing cooking resources contains a Vittles Index so you can find how to make an authentic Stack Cake, liniment, Sawmill Gravy, many kinds of pickles, and much more. 300 pages, spiral bound for easy use. The Great Smokies Welcome Center is located on U.S. 321 in Townsend, TN, 2 miles from the west entrance to Great Smoky Mountains National Park. Visitors can get information about things to see and do in and around the national park and shop from a wide selection of books, gifts, and other Smokies merchandise. Daily, weekly, and annual parking tags for the national park are also available.
